Digimon: Digital Monsters Battle Spirit

4 Rating: 4, Useful: 3 / 3
Date: June 29, 2003
Author: Amazon User

Digimon Battle Spirit is a pretty good game. The fact that you can unlock characters is awsome. And it's not just a piece of cake to unlock characters either! You have to meet certain requirements to unlock them. Each character has their own abilities, so you don't have a few different characters with the same attacks and such. This game is a game for people who like challenges.

Not bad, but not entirely good either...

4 Rating: 4, Useful: 0 / 0
Date: August 02, 2007
Author: Amazon User

This game can be really slow paced unless your playing with a Digimon that has speed (like Renamon). This game pretty much plots Digimon from seasons 1-3 and pits them against them against each other in a melee type battle. What determines a win? When you hit a Digimon with certain attacks, they drop little balls called D-Spirits. The Digimon with the most D-Spirits at the end of a round wins. Simple, yet effective. However, once a round, Calumon will come around and the player that gets to him first evolves to Ultimate (or Mega). If your opponent gets to him first, better start running. I would recommend this game ONLY to Digimon fans who would be unable to purchase a Wonderswan Crystal and Digimon Battle Spirit 1.5 (a Battle Spirit game that is much better than this one that America never got).
